According to data from the Missouri Highway Patrol, there are nearly 8,000 accidents that involve 18-wheelers each year in Missouri. Of these accidents, one in five truck accidents results in an injury, and sadly, 1.5% of truck crashes prove fatal. Special damages include any financial consequences caused by a negligent party. Below is a list of some of the most common financial damages paid out to a victim after a truck accident:
- Lost wages or loss of income potential
- The cost of any damaged property and repairs
- Direct (and future) medical expenses, ambulance fees, etc.
- Ongoing therapy, treatments, and prescriptions
- Childcare, home care, and travel expenses
Any “out of pocket” expenses may be added on to special damages. Combs Waterkotte’s Lawrence County, MO, truck accident attorneys will identify what compensation you can get.
General damages aren’t as easy to define. These may include mental anguish, pain, suffering, loss of a loved one, physical impairment, and others. A major truck accident has lasting implications and general damages are meant to compensate them. What to Do After a Truck Accident
One of the most important things to do after a truck crash is, of course, to seek medical attention. Get well, be safe. As mentioned above, damages are largely reliant on documentation and tracking expenses. If you are a victim (or a family member was), and have even minor injuries, having that documentation is crucial.
It’s important to prove liability and negligence. Did somebody cause the victim’s death? What were the circumstances? Autopsies and medical records are extremely important. It’s helpful to file a claim as soon as you can while witness testimonies and evidence are still available. Some states have set statutes of limitations on how long you can wait before pursuing a claim.
The next thing you need to do is call a lawyer. The quicker you take action, the quicker you’re going to solve the problem at hand. It is important to collect any and all information you can. Eye-witness reports, the at-fault party’s insurance information, and other documents help. Keep a journal about any treatments or pain and suffering.
